Abstract

Western Maharashtra is one of the important regions of the Maharashtra for exporting the commodities. This region includes the five districts i.e. Kolhapur, Pune, Satara, Sagali and Solapur. This research paper has focused on the exporters’ problems in Western Maharashtra as well as reflected the picture of district wise problems of exporters and what the prospects of exporters in Western Maharashtra are. This research study is based on the primary data and used the various statistical techniques such as percentage and chi-square test. This study concluded that the exporters have faced the majority problems; are legal problems, tariff problems, currencies fluctuations and price variations as compared to government restrictions problems in Western Maharashtra and there is more potentiality to improve the exports from this region.
